The Final Stretch of Delivery in the Age of E-Commerce

In today's rapidly landscape of e-commerce, consumers demand swift and dependable delivery experiences. The last mile, that essential leg of the journey from warehouse to customer doorstep, has emerged into a major hurdle for businesses. Factors such as rising order volume, population density, and client expectations for instantaneous tracking have heightened the complexities of last mile delivery. Improving this crucial stage is paramount to maximizing customer satisfaction, minimizing costs, and obtaining a advantageous edge in the e-commerce.

Building an Efficient Fulfillment Network for E-Commerce

In today's quickly evolving e-commerce landscape, establishing a robust and streamlined fulfillment network is critical. Consumers expect swift delivery, and businesses must adapt to meet these demands. A well-designed fulfillment network includes various components, such as warehousing, order handling, packing, and shipping. Improving each of these processes can substantially improve operational productivity and overall customer satisfaction.

  • Essential considerations when building an efficient fulfillment network include:
  • Integration: Embracing automation to accelerate tasks such as order picking.
  • Stock Control: Implementing effective inventory management systems to eliminate stockouts and leverage storage space.
  • Transportation: Establishing strategic partnerships with reliable shipping carriers and optimizing delivery routes.
